Regina Daniel is an Advocate and Solicitor of the High Court of Malaya, bringing more than three decades of experience in civil and commercial litigation. She acts for corporations, banks, and individual clients in disputes where financial exposure, operational risk, and reputation demand careful management.

Her practice is guided by a clear principle: every dispute must be approached with structure, precision, and a defined objective.

Regina received her LL.B (Hons.) (Ext.) from the University of London and completed the Certificate in Legal Practice (CLP). She was admitted to the Bar in 1991.

Professional Experience

Regina began her legal career in Kuala Lumpur, completing her pupillage and starting as a legal assistant. During this early stage, she gained a solid foundation in litigation, handling a wide array of civil matters and gaining essential courtroom experience.

She subsequently joined another firm, representing banks, financial institutions, and corporate clients. Her work was centred on banking litigation, corporate recovery, and enforcement proceedings, which established her technical expertise in structured financial disputes and creditor actions.

As her career progressed, Regina worked alongside senior practitioners, expanding her experience into commercial disputes, property litigation, and contentious advisory work. She handled cases involving contractual breakdowns, directors and shareholder disputes, association disputes between the members and committee and disputes with significant financial consequences.

In 2015, Regina founded Regina Daniel & Co., where she practised as a sole proprietor for ten years. During this period, she managed a diverse range of clients, including high-value disputes, and built her clientele on reliability and efficiency.

In 2026, Regina Daniel & Co merged with Low & Partners, a multi-branch firm with international affiliations. Regina now serves as a Principal Associate, continuing to actively practice while broadening her advisory scope to include a wider client base, including foreign clients.

Notable Cases/Transactions

Regina’s experience includes acting in disputes with substantial financial and commercial impact:

  • Secured judgment for a foreign company exceeding RM19 million for breach of contract and consequential damages.
  • Secured judgment exceeding RM11 million for breach of contract and consequential damages for a foreign company.
  • Successfully defended a corporate client against claims over RM2 million involving tort and contractual issues.
  • Represented banks and financial institutions in recovery and enforcement actions, ranging from smaller claims to matters exceeding RM1 million.
  • Acted for clients in shareholder disputes, construction claims, and a variety of commercial and civil litigation in the various courts in Peninsular Malaysia.
  • Handled trademark infringement and patent infringement actions.
